My Cut Out Animation




The materials I used for my cut paper animation was black card and white paper. I used the white paper for the background of my animation and I used the black card to create the scenery and the lions. I firstly sketched out the lions body shapes on to the black card I split up lions body into seven separate pieces the head,tail,legs and the body. The first time I tried to film my animation the camera position would keep changing which made my animation not as clean as I would have liked. So I put my camera onto tripod so that the position would stay the same. I did all the body parts when creating my animation the only thing I moved on the lions was there legs and sometimes there heads or body. To make it look like if the lions were moving I moved the scenery around to make it look like they were walking across Africa. What I think was successful about my animation was that the lions looked like they was walking across Africa and did not look unrealistic what I would improve is maybe making my animation a bit longer and maybe creating some more scenery around the lion.
